I have found a food intolerence - coconut. Is there anything else I sould be careful of?

9 replies

KatyMac · 15/10/2011 18:22

I know things tend to go in groups

I have 3 absolute confirmed intolerances, found by exclusion

Nutrasweet - very fast acting
Almond - contact allergy if I eat it I get mouth ulcers & if it's in toiletries I get a rash

& now coconut - also very fast acting

I am fairly sure I have others; but whether my tummy problems are all intolerances or if I have IBS as well is still debatable
